Description

StudioTilt Speaker Stand

 

Modern and compact speaker stand for desktop speakers and small studio monitors with a footprint of approximately 14 × 16 cm.
Designed and tested with the Hercules XPS 2.0 60 DJ Set, but compatible with many other compact speakers of similar size.

The stand combines a clean geometric design with vibration damping and an optimized listening angle for desktop use.

Features

  • Modular 3-part design
  • Fits speakers around 14 × 16 cm
  • Optimized desktop listening position
  • 3.6° backward tilt for improved sound direction
  • Driver/tweeter center height at approx. 24.5 cm
  • TPU vibration damping insert
  • Compact and stable construction
  • Modern geometric look
  • Easy to print and assemble

Assembly

The stand consists of 3 separate parts:

1. Base Structure

Provides stability and supports the upper platform.

2. Geometric Top Plate

The speaker platform connects to the base using alignment pins.

3. TPU Insert

A flexible TPU layer acts as a vibration dampener to reduce resonance and desk vibrations.

Custom Sizes

The top plate can easily be adapted for different speaker dimensions.
If you need another size, feel free to ask — I can adjust the model for your speakers.

Recommended Print Settings

Main Parts

  • PLA or PETG
  • 0.2 mm layer height
  • 15–25% infill
  • 3–4 walls

TPU Insert

  • TPU
  • 10–20% infill

Notes

The stand was designed for compact desktop audio setups, gaming desks, and small studio environments where speaker positioning and vibration control matter.
